✅ Ingredients:
- 800g potatoes
- 600g minced meat (beef or pork)
- 1 egg
- Salt and black pepper (to taste)
- Sweet paprika (to taste)
- Italian herbs mix (optional)
- 2 onions (finely chopped)
- 2 cloves garlic (minced)
- Fresh parsley and dill (chopped)
- 3 tablespoons flour
- Butter (for frying)
- Vegetable oil
🥄 For the Creamy Mushroom Sauce:
- 150g mushrooms (sliced)
- 1 tablespoon flour
- 200ml sour cream
- Salt and black pepper (to taste)
- 1 teaspoon sugar (optional)
- Italian herbs (optional)
🥗 Optional Side Salad:
- Mixed salad greens
- 1 cucumber (sliced)
- 2 tomatoes (sliced)
- ½ red onion (thinly sliced)
- Salt and black pepper
- 1 teaspoon French mustard
- Olive oil
👨🍳 Instructions:
Step 1: Prepare the Potato Mixture
Peel and grate the potatoes. Squeeze out excess moisture using a clean kitchen towel. Transfer to a large bowl.
Step 2: Add Flavorful Mix-ins
Add finely chopped onions, minced garlic, fresh herbs, salt, pepper, and sweet paprika. Stir well to combine.
Step 3: Add Egg & Breadcrumbs
Crack in the egg and add flour. Mix thoroughly until everything is evenly combined and slightly sticky.
Step 4: Fry Until Golden
Heat a mixture of butter and vegetable oil in a skillet. Spoon portions of the potato mixture into the pan and press into flat patties. Fry on medium heat for about 4–5 minutes per side until golden brown and crispy.
Step 5: Cook the Minced Meat Filling
In a separate pan, cook the minced meat with onions, garlic, herbs, salt, and pepper until browned and cooked through. Set aside.
Step 6: Make the Creamy Mushroom Sauce
In the same pan, melt a bit of butter. Add sliced mushrooms and sauté briefly. Stir in flour, then slowly add sour cream. Simmer gently while stirring until thickened. Season with salt, pepper, sugar, and herbs if desired.
Step 7: Serve & Enjoy
Serve the potato patties warm with the minced meat filling spooned on top and a generous drizzle of mushroom sauce. Pair with a fresh garden salad for a complete meal!
📝 Tips:
- Use leftover mashed potatoes to save time.
- Substitute minced meat with lentils or mushrooms for a vegetarian version.
- Store leftovers in the fridge and reheat in a skillet or oven.
- Bake instead of fry for a healthier version (at 180°C / 350°F for 20–25 minutes).
